Use up your extra yarn with this comfy, crocheted pouf seat. With this pattern, you can clean out your yarn collection, make a unique design, fill that empty corner of your home, and gain a functional seat all at the same time! You can stuff your pouf with polyfil or bean bag filler, or simply use extra throws, sheets, towels, or pillows that you no longer need. Crochet Basket Weave Cushion Cover
Almost the entire pattern is done in the front loop only single crochet stitch (flo sc). This keeps the project super simple, but adds enough of a change to give the piece a little more texture. When you’re short on time and short on throw pillows too, then reach for that extra thick blanket yarn. The jumbo weight yarn makes this textured pillow project absolutely fly by. You’ll be using half double crochet and front post treble crochet stitches for this one.
